6. Is Symphytum officinale safe for everyday use?
Comfrey tea is generally safe when consumed in moderation, but it’s important not to exceed recommended doses as high amounts can be harmful.
7. What are the side effects of Symphytum officinale?
Ingesting large amounts of comfrey can be harmful to the liver. Always follow recommended guidelines and consult with a healthcare professional if unsure.
